No, it doesn't. PU leather doesn't act much like leather at all. It does not go more supple over time, and it does not change color or develop a patina(ex: the vachetta on real Louis Vuittons develops this patina, a PU leather counterfeit would not)
PU Leather is when a Polyurethane sheet is applied to a thin leather back when used in the furniture industry. A leather pattern can be stamped on the PU to make it look and feel like top grain leather. PVC - Polyvinyl Chloride is also manufactured in a similar manner but is normally placed on a cotton or polyester backing. Pattern can also be applied to the surface. PVC can be a more durable surface than PU, but does not feel like leather. Also referred to as Vinyl covering for Furniture use.

artificial leather is made from PU or PVC by using release paper and also a fabric as a base material.
